Patients with resolution of low‐lying placenta and placenta previa remain at increased risk of postpartum hemorrhage

Abstract

Despite high rates of resolution of low-lying placenta and placenta previa by term, women with resolved low placentation remain at increased risk of postpartum hemorrhage compared to those with normal placentation throughout pregnancy. © 2021 International Society of Ultrasound in Obstetrics and Gynecology.
